Output 82e86b0a7179520077e942f1db85e39ffa5cfe7e9ecb1eeb2bcdd2aaca99a60e:1

value
1000147
script pubkey
OP_0 OP_PUSHBYTES_20 cdfbad0984bd2895213aa1b12c38d01a8b838ef4
address
bc1qeha66zvyh55f2gf65xcjcwxsr29c8rh56385g6
transaction
82e86b0a7179520077e942f1db85e39ffa5cfe7e9ecb1eeb2bcdd2aaca99a60e
confirmations
656
spent
true